Ballistics
Definition of Ballistics
Bal`lis´tics
n.
1.
The
science
or
art
of
hurling
missile
weapons
by the use of an
engine
.
2.
The
science
treating
the
motion
of
projectiles
in
flight
,
especially
when they are in
free
fall
within
the
earth
's
gravitational
field
.
3.
The
study
of the
characteristics
of a
cartridge
fired
from a
firearm
, and of the
processes
occurring
during
the
discharge
of a
firearm
.
4.
The
division
within
a
police
department
which
studies
the
characteristics
of
cartridges
fired
from a
firearm
; the
ballistics
department
. The
characteristics
of the
weapons
and
bullets
fired
may be used as
evidence
in
criminal
investigations
.
